ASCA observations of Mrk 1040 & MS 0225 . 5 + 3121 3

We present ASCA observations of the Seyfert 1 galaxies Mrk 1040 and MS 0225.5+3121. Mrk 1040 was found to have decreased in ux by almost a factor of 4 since an EXOSAT observation 10 years ago. The energy spectrum of Mrk 1040 displays complexity both at soft energies (below 0.8 keV) and at hard energies (6{7 keV). The latter is readily interpreted as uorescent K emission from cold iron expected when the primary X-ray source illuminates cold optically-thick material. This line is both broad (with FWHM 16 000{70000 km s 1) and strong (equivalent width 550 250 eV) suggesting that it originates from material close to the compact object with non-solar abundances. Abundance eeects on the equivalent width of such a line are investigated via Monte Carlo simulations. We nd that strong lines can be produced with physically plausible abundances. The eeect of abundances on the associated reeection continuum is also discussed. The soft spectral complexity implies either a strong soft excess together with intrinsic absorption, or a complex absorber. Various models for the nature of such a complex absorber are discussed. MS 0225.5+3121 shows no evidence for any variability and has a spectrum that is well described by a power law with Galactic absorption.
